    This venue has been here for 38 years!!! I can honestly say that none of the arcade halls I grew up with exist anymore! Never been, first time in for a birthday boy! Tight space (thx covid). Black lights? Oh yeah! Obvious old school love judging from the wall decor alone. Some unique machines here, some I have never seen before. SUPER nice and sweet staff. Pinball, they got it. Highlights? 4 player Pac Man.The biggest surprise? My youngest bday boy could not turn away from the challenge of Flaming Finger, pumped a fair amount of coins into this one and won no less than two prize doors https://youtu.be/3m4fMQUU3P4. The Konami games seemed to be a hit as well, what's that you say? You're old school? They have you covered. Galaga, Burger Time, etc. They also do private events. Go ahead and get your game on!

    My son wanted to go to an arcade. Star Worlds fit the bill today. We've been to Chicagoland's most infamous arcades and this one should be included to that list. Smaller than the others, Star Worlds is confined to maybe 40-50 games. They don't have the assortment like the other larger arcades but then again, they don't charge $15 to play either. Nope, it's $5 for 30 tokens and you feed the machines old school style. Kind of liked that. We played a few of the classic shooting games and of course the staples like Pac-Man, Galaga, Robotron, etc. They did have one game here that I've never seen before called Revolution. It's a shooting game with an Aerosmith theme. Good stuff...Evan and I fed tokens in for a half hour as we shot our way through anti-music goons. The owner is a nice guy. He wants to keep his 30yr old operation on the small side, and keep it fun. He's done a nice job. FYI..cash only. That's part of the old school charm. Cheers!

    I've been to this location twice. We came here on NYE and were able to do the 60 min session. The…read more90 min session was not available but 60 min is more than enough to try all of the rooms at least once. After that, you can choose to go back to your favorite ones. There are free lockers to put your belongings as well as a free coat check. There are restrooms and a water fountain in the very back. There is a lounge area that is used for private parties but you can also just sit in there. You can watch other people play on the big screen. I recommend wearing casual or active attire because you'll get a workout for sure Each game room has a variety of levels and different types of games within that room. The cost per person is cheaper Mon - Thurs. $20.99 for 60 mins. $26.99 for 90 mins. Fri - Sun it's $26.99 for 60 mins and $38.99 for 90 mins. For Mondays and holidays, it's best to check back because the prices do change. I highly recommend booking on the website instead of blindly going there. The slots fill up fast. The games are short so you don't have to wait long to go into that room. The room types are arena, climb, grid, hoops, mega laser, hide, control, mega grid, strike, portals, and press. The staff were all friendly and helpful. There's no issue with finding parking.
